Students from UCF’s Burnett Honors College are bringing the warmth and joy of the holidays to underprivileged youth from local elementary schools.

Honors students distributed nearly 150 baskets of food to nine schools that participate in the college’s civic engagement programs. Non-perishable items were collected throughout October and November for the annual Thanks and Giving Food Drive, which supports families that can’t afford Thanksgiving dinners.

Through Monday, Dec. 13, the college is seeking new and gently used clothes and shoes and unwrapped toiletries to give to the resource centers at schools where students often lack clothing and grooming necessities.
